titleOfInvention | A liquid crystal sealer composite and a manufacturing method of a liquid crystal display panel by the composite being used |
abstract | A liquid crystal sealer composite in the present invention is characterized by being a one component type thermo-and-photo curing resin composite comprising (1) solid epoxy resin having a softening point temperature of 40 degrees Celsius in the ring and ball method, (2) an acrylate monomer and/or a methacrylate monomer or their oligomers, (3) a thermoplastic polymer having a softening point temperature of 50 to 120 degrees Celsius in the ring and ball method, obtained by copolymerization of an acrylate monomer and/or a methacrylate monomer and a monomer being able to be copolymerized with those monomers, (4) a photo radical polymerization initiator and (5) a latent epoxy curing agent. By the present invention, it becomes possible to offer a thermo-and-photo curing liquid crystal sealer composite, which can be used for the liquid crystal dropping method, which especially has an excellent cured product property after having cured at the first stage, thereby cell gaps being stable after formation of the cell gaps, and is prevented from a liquid crystal being contaminated during a thermo curing process at the second stage and, besides, which has an excellent curing property in a light blocked area and excellent adhesion reliability. Further, by using the liquid crystal sealer composite according to the present invention, it becomes possible to offer a liquid crystal display panel, which has an excellent display property, especially in the light blocked area in a wiring portion. |
